Griffin Funds Roosevelt Library

Hedge fund king Kenneth Griffin just gave $26 million to finish Theodore Roosevelt’s long-awaited presidential library—set to open July 4, 2026, on America’s 250th birthday. The new west wing, named after Griffin, will house exhibits, learning spaces, and gathering areas dedicated to the 26th president, who never had a library during his lifetime. Located in the North Dakota Badlands—the place where Roosevelt found solace after personal tragedy and forged his conservation legacy—the library will be the nation’s first carbon-neutral presidential library.
